WebApr 11, 2024 · Pitted keratolysis is usually asymptomatic. However, when you do have symptoms, the most common effect is a noticeable odor from the feet.This is due to the skin infection on the bottom of the feet.

Treatment for pitted keratolysis focuses on removing the bacterial infection from your body. Your healthcare provider will prescribe topical antibioticsthat you rub on your skin like a lotion. Antibiotics could include: 1. Clindamycin. 2. Erythromycin. 3. Fusidic acid. 4. Mupirocin.
